Rumah  >  Artikel  >  hujung hadapan web  >  Perbezaan antara ref dan props dalam vue

Perbezaan antara ref dan props dalam vue

下次还敢
下次还敢asal
2024-05-02 22:39:36484semak imbas

Perbezaan antara ref dan prop dalam Vue: ref ialah kaedah yang menunjuk kepada contoh komponen dan boleh digunakan untuk mengendalikan komponen secara dinamik ialah sifat yang digunakan untuk menerima data daripada komponen induk.

Perbezaan antara ref dan props dalam vue

Perbezaan antara ref dan Props dalam Vue

Dalam Vue, ref dan props ialah dua mekanisme berbeza untuk mengurus data dan gelagat komponen.

ref

  • Definisi: Kaedah yang menunjuk kepada contoh komponen.
  • Penggunaan: Anda boleh menggunakan atribut ref untuk menetapkan contoh komponen kepada pembolehubah. ref 属性将组件实例分配给一个变量。
  • 目的:允许直接访问组件实例,从而可以动态地操作它。
  • 访问方式:使用 this.$refs 对象,例如 this.$refs.myComponent

Props

  • 定义:组件从父组件接收数据的属性。
  • 用法:使用 props 选项定义组件需要接收的属性,然后使用 v-bind 指令将数据传递给组件。
  • 目的:允许组件与父组件通信并共享数据。
  • 访问方式:可以使用 this.propName
Tujuan:

Membenarkan akses terus kepada tika komponen supaya ia boleh dimanipulasi secara dinamik.

Kaedah akses: Gunakan objek this.$refs, seperti this.$refs.myComponent. PropsDefinisi: Sifat yang komponen menerima data daripada komponen induk. Gunakan pilihan props untuk menentukan sifat yang komponen perlu terima, dan kemudian gunakan arahan v-bind untuk menghantar data kepada komponen . Membenarkan komponen berkomunikasi dan berkongsi data dengan komponen induk. Anda boleh menggunakan this.propName untuk mengakses data prop. Perbezaan utamaCiri-cirirefpropsJenisKaedah
Penggunaan: Tujuan:
Kaedah akses:

Kaedah akses

dinamik

statik🎜🎜🎜🎜aliran data 🎜🎜Sehala (dari anak kepada ibu bapa) 🎜🎜Sehala (daripada ibu bapa kepada anak) 🎜🎜🎜🎜Tujuan 🎜🎜Komponen operasi dinamik🎜🎜Terima data luaran🎜🎜🜎🎜🎜🎜🎜🎜 🎜🎜ref untuk dinamik mengakses dan memanipulasi kejadian komponen, manakala prop digunakan untuk menerima data daripada komponen induk. Kedua-duanya adalah alat penting untuk mengurus data komponen dalam Vue, tetapi menggunakan mekanisme yang berbeza berdasarkan keperluan yang berbeza. 🎜

Atas ialah kandungan terperinci Perbezaan antara ref dan props dalam vue.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Kandungan artikel ini disumbangkan secara sukarela oleh netizen, dan hak cipta adalah milik pengarang asal. Laman web ini tidak memikul tanggungjawab undang-undang yang sepadan. Jika anda menemui sebarang kandungan yang disyaki plagiarisme atau pelanggaran, sila hubungi admin@php.cn